Bekanntlich müssen die für die Herstellung der verschiedenen Papiere verwendeten Cellulosefasern nach den Vorgängen des Kochens, Bleichens, Reinigens usw. mit Chemikalien versetzt werden, die ihre Wasserfestigkeit erhöhen sollen.It is known that the cellulose fibers used for the production of the various papers must chemicals are added after cooking, bleaching, cleaning, etc. to increase their water resistance.
Das hierfür üblichste Mittel ist das Natriumresinat, das durch Aluminiumsulfat als Aluminiumresinat auf der Faser niedergeschlagen wird.The most common means for this is sodium resinate, which is replaced by aluminum sulfate as aluminum resinate is deposited on the fiber.
Es wurde nun gefunden, daß man besonders wertvolle und den bisherigen Verfahren überlegene Ergebnisse hinsichtlich der Wasserfestigkeit und der Oberflächenbeschaffenheit des Papiers erzielen kann. Erfindungsgemäß wird dabei an Stelle des Natriumresinats eine Harzemulsion verwendet, die außerdem noch Paraffin und Zusatzstoffe, wie Netzmittel für die Erleichterung des Eindringens und fungizide Mittel, zur Verhinderung der Schimmelbildung enthält.It has now been found that they are particularly valuable and superior to the previous processes Achieve results in terms of water resistance and surface quality of the paper can. According to the invention, instead of the sodium resinate, a resin emulsion is used which also paraffin and additives such as wetting agents to facilitate penetration and contains fungicides to prevent mold growth.
Nachstehend ist zur näheren Erläuterung ein Ausführungsbeispiel für das Verfahren gegeben.An exemplary embodiment of the method is given below for a more detailed explanation.
Man vermischt in einem Kollergang bei einer Temperatur von 6o bis 8o°:Mix in a pan at a temperature of 6o to 8o °:
Harzseife (zu 25% aus Natriumresinat) 5 bis 25 kg Alkylarylsulfosaures Natrium . . . 1 bis 10 kgResin soap (25% from sodium resinate) 5 to 25 kg of alkylarylsulfonate sodium. . . 1 to 10 kg
Gelatine 20 bis 5 kgGelatin 20 to 5 kg
Paraffin 40 bis 5 kgParaffin 40 to 5 kg
Pentachlornatriumphenolat . . . . 1 bis 2 % Wasser bis auf 100 kg auffüllen.Pentachloro sodium phenolate. . . . 1 to 2 % Fill up with water up to 100 kg.
Die Harzseife kann ganz oder teilweise durch andere Erzeugnisse ersetzt werden, die ebenfalls unlösliche Aluminiumsalze ergeben, z. B. durch Seifen von Fettsäuren, Alkalisalze der Carboxymethyl-The resin soap can be replaced in whole or in part by other products that also result in insoluble aluminum salts, e.g. B. by soaps of fatty acids, alkali salts of the carboxymethyl
cellulose, Alginate usw. Auch Harnstoff kann zugesetzt werden.cellulose, alginates, etc. Urea can also be added.
Die Emulsion ist völlig beständig und kann in jedem Verhältnis mit Wasser ohne Rücksicht auf dessen Härte oder pH-Wert verdünnt werden.The emulsion is completely permanent and can be used in any proportion with water regardless of whose hardness or pH value are diluted.
Die so hergestellte Emulsion wird wie folgt angewandt: Sie wird in einer solchen Menge in einen Holländers gebracht, daß 0,5 bis io°/o Paraffin auf trockenen Zellstoff verwendet werden.The emulsion thus prepared is applied as follows: it is in such an amount in a Holländers said that 0.5 to 10 per cent of paraffin was used on dry pulp.
Der Zusatz eines Netzmittels zur Emulsion begünstigt nicht nur die Emulgierung, sondern führt auch zu einer beträchtlichen Verbesserung der Verteilung der Emulsion auf der Cellulosefaser und sogar des Eindringens derselben in die Cellulosefaser, was im Hinblick auf die gewünschte Wirkung von großer Bedeutung ist.The addition of a wetting agent to the emulsion not only favors emulsification, it also leads to it also to a considerable improvement in the distribution of the emulsion on the cellulose fiber and even the penetration of the same into the cellulose fiber, which in view of the desired effect is of great importance.
Sowie das Cellulose-Emulsionsgemisch eine gute Homogenität aufweist, wird zur Fällung als AIuminiumresinat Aluminiumsulfat zugesetzt. Man muß am Schluß bei einem ρκ-Wert von 4,5 arbeiten. Ist das Gemisch richtig homogen geworden, so läuft es durch die Papiermaschine, ohne daß hierdurch das Verfahren der Papierherstellung eine Änderung erführe.As soon as the cellulose-emulsion mixture has a good homogeneity, aluminum resinate is used for precipitation Aluminum sulfate added. At the end you have to work with a ρκ value of 4.5. If the mixture has become really homogeneous, it runs through the paper machine without this the papermaking process is changing.
Es kann jedoch auch so verfahren werden, daß man die wie oben hergestellte Emulsion alsbald nach ihrer Herstellung mit einem Aluminiumsalz versetzt und das so gewonnene Produkt zur Verarbeitung bringt, wobei sich die spätere Ausfällung mit einem Aluminiumsalz erübrigt, wodurch das Verfahren noch weiter vereinfacht wird.However, it is also possible to proceed in such a way that the emulsion prepared as above is immediately used After their production, an aluminum salt is added and the product obtained in this way for processing brings, whereby the later precipitation with an aluminum salt is unnecessary, whereby the Procedure is further simplified.
Das nach dem vorliegenden Verfahren erhaltene Papier zeichnet sich durch eine hohe Undurchlässigkeit, die bei einem Paraffingehalt von wenigen Prozenten vollständig sein kann, und durch eine beträchtliche Verbesserung der Gleichmäßigkeit seiner Flächen aus.The paper obtained by the present process is characterized by high impermeability, which can be complete with a paraffin content of a few percent, and by a considerable amount Improve the evenness of its surfaces.
